Pavers hardscaping services involve installing durable, attractive stone or concrete pavers to create functional outdoor surfaces. These services typically include designing and laying pat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as. The process often involves preparing the ground, leveling the surface, and carefully placing the pavers to ensure stability and a smooth appearance. Homeowners in Silver Spring, MD and surrounding areas often choose pavers for their ability to enhance curb appeal and provide a long-lasting outdoor space that can withstand weather and regular use.
One of the main problems pavers hardscaping helps address is uneven or damaged outdoor surfaces. Cracked or sinking concrete driveways and worn-out patios can detract from a home's appearance and pose safety hazards. Pavers offer a practical solution by replacing or covering these problem areas with a more resilient and visually appealing surface. Additionally, paver installations can help improve drainage around the property, reducing issues caused by pooling water or poor runoff, which can lead to erosion or foundation problems over time.

The overview below groups typical Pavers Hardsc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Silver Spring,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or paver repairs or small hardscaping touch-ups in Silver Spring range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ials used.
Patterned or Custom Paver Installations - Installing patterned or decorative paver surfaces usually costs between $2,000-$5,000 for standard projects. Larger, more intricate designs or extensive areas can push costs higher, often exceeding $5,000.
Complete Driveway or Patio Replacement - Full replacement of existing paver surfaces generally ranges from $8,000-$15,000, with larger or more complex projects reaching beyond $20,000. Many local contractors handle projects in the middle of this range, depending on size and detail.
Large-Scale Hardscaping Projects - Extensive outdoor living spaces or multiple areas can cost $20,000 and up, with highly customized or complex designs potentially exceeding $50,000. Such projects are less common and typically involve detailed planning and high-end mater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ating contractors for pavers and hardscaping projects, it’s important to consider their experience with similar types of work. Homeowners should look for service providers who have a proven track record in installing patios, walkways, or driveways that match the scope and style of the desired project. Asking for examples of completed projects or references can help gauge their familiarity with the specific materials and techniques needed, ensuring they understand the nuances involved in creating durable, visually appealing hardscaping features.
Clear, written expectations are essential to a successful project. Homeowners should seek service providers who can provide detailed proposals outlining the scope of work, materials to be used, and the steps involved in completing the project. Having these expectations documented hel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a basis for comparing different contractors. It’s also beneficial to discuss any questions or concerns upfront to ensure all parties are aligned before work begins.
Reputable references and effective communication are key indicators of a reliable contractor.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references from previous clients and follow up to learn about their experiences. Good communication throughout the process-such as responsiveness to inquiries and willingness to explain project details-can significantly impact the overall experience.
